Two out of SIX Pre-Release Stages Done

  • Infrastructures (database):
    • [WIP => DONE] adjustment into the determination of infrastructure levels (IL). For reminder, IL encompass grossly the size of an infrastructure into one readable data that is used, among other things, to determine the size of the settlements. Now it is calculated with one universal formula based on the design of each infrastructure. So no more guessing.
    • [WIP => DONE] add new sets of data to indicate the minimum size of settlement allowed to an infrastructure to be converted/assembled or built, for each index of size of infrastructure. These replace the min/max level. These applies to the following types of settlements: Surface, Space-Based, Subterranean, Lava Tube and Asteroid.
    • [New: DONE] add an infrastructure level, by index of size available for an infrastructure. 
    • [New: DONE] the data to indicate the range of settlements is deprecated since the new data for min/max settlement’s sizes do the job.
  • Infrastructures (database) / Data Addons and Modifications:
    • [New: DONE] Multipurpose Depot:
      • dimensions and base power consumed are completely reworked and there are no more than 3 size levels now.
      • this infrastructure now uses Colonists as staff: 3, 4 or 6 colonists respectively. There were no staff prerequisite before.
      • the calculations for the different storage values are also completely redone. The Gas storage type is removed from the custom effects of this infrastructure.
    • [New: DONE] Pressurized Tanks Array => Pressurized Tanks Array – Gas: total overhaul of the data. Gas storage only.
    • [New: DONE] Pressurized Tanks Array – Liquid: new infrastructure for liquid storage.
  • Missions / Colonization:
    • [NOT DEV] fix: during the setup of the mission, if the list of types of settlements isn’t continuous regarding the data vs what is available in the combo box, the type of settlement committed in the task will be wrong.
      For ex.: the enumeration of the three first types is; setSurface -> setSpaceBasedSurface -> setSubterranean. If Space-Based surface isn’t part of the list of the combo box, the selection will be wrong.
  • Products:
    • [New: DONE] Multipurpose Depot: the now deprecated levels of infrastructure are removed. For the rest, the volume/unit for each level is adjusted by the new values.
    • [New: DONE] Pressurized Tanks Array: the now deprecated levels of infrastructure are removed. The rest is removed in exchange of Pressurized Tanks Array – Gas and a second one with Liquid. Total remake of the data.
  • Products / Addition of Equipments:
    • [New: DONE] Pressurized Tanks Array – Liquid: *3 for each size index.
  • Settlements:
    • [WIP => DONE] adjustements to determine the size, and the progression of it, for all the types of settlements. Calculations are 100% in-line with the new way to determine the infrastructure level.

Here is the updated list of pre-release stages:

  1. to adjust the Oxygen Production Overload by taking into account the population in excess of the life support system of a colony.
  2. to adjust the infrastructure levels in the database, the size of discovered resource spots (in line with IL) and also adjust how the size of a settlement is determined (also in line with the new IL).
  3. to finalize the implementation of the offline version of the knowledge base in the game. It is already here but a I need to remake the linking between the data and the explanations in the KB. That implies also to remove the old code of the previous encyclopedia.
  4. to fix a major bug in the Colonization Mission, in the case when only one carried colonization vessel is selected for the mission. The trip time doesn’t update and it can create a bug. 
  5. to fix a bug again for the Colonization Mission: during the setup of the mission, if the list of types of settlements isn’t continuous regarding the data vs what is available in the combo box, the type of settlement committed in the task will be wrong.
  6. FINALLY… to complete a presentable interface of the online updater that will display basic information like the version and build available, the last changes and buttons to let the player decide which action to take.

Yes, it is now six steps, since I discovered a new bug between the types of settlement available with the interface In the future and the one committed in the mission’s data itself. It’s not a big work to do, but must be done.

The work on the new Infrastructure Levels was a bit meaty, I add to redo all the basic data of the infrastructures already in the game. But it is past now.
There will be some secondary adjustments for the interface of the Conversion/Assembling/Building system, even if most of it is modified now.

So… two items out of six done, tomorrow I will work on the next one; the completion of the interface for the offline Knowledge Base.

That’s all for now, good night and have a great tomorrow!

